Categories:: 5.1.12. Principles and Documents of Government
Statements:
A. Evaluate the major arguments advanced for the necessity of government.
B. Analyze the sources, purposes and functions of law.
C. Evaluate the importance of the principles and ideals of civic life.
E. Evaluate the principles and ideals that shape the United States and compare them to documents of government.
F. Analyze and assess the rights of the people as listed in the Pennsylvania Constitution and the Constitution of the United States.
G. Analyze and interpret the role of the United States Flag in civil disobedience and in patriotic activities.
H. Analyze the competing positions held by the framers of the basic documents of government of Pennsylvania and United States.
I. Analyze historical examples of the importance of the rule of law explaining the sources, purposes and functions of law.
J. Analyze how the law promotes the common good and protects individual rights.
K. Analyze the roles of symbols and holidays in society.
M. Evaluate and analyze the importance of significant political speeches and writings in civic life (e.g., Diary of Anne Frank, Silent Spring).
D. Analyze the principles and ideals that shape the government of Pennsylvania and apply them to the government.
L. Analyze Pennsylvania and United States court decisions that have affected principles and ideals of government in civic life.
